In vivo antimalarial activity of Ajuga remota water extracts against Plasmodium berghei in mice.

We investigated the in vivo activity of crude water extracts of Ajuga remota Benth (Labiatae) against Plasmodium berghei in mice using plants harvested from two areas in Kenya where the plant is commonly used to treat malaria.
